![]() ![]() ![]() ![]() One hypothesis is that they spread hematogenously following introduction into the blood during tooth brushing, dental cleanings, or subsequent to oral diseases such as periodontitis. All HACEK organisms are commensals of the human oropharynx but how they travel to distal sites to cause disease is not fully established. The HACEK group is not based on taxonomic relationships but on the organisms’ propensity to cause endocarditis. HACEK Organisms are Associated with Infective Endocarditis The acronym stands for H aemophilus, Aggregatibacter, C ardiobacterium, E ikenella, and K ingella: all HACEK members are fastidious Gram-negative bacteria associated with infective endocarditis. The acronym “HACEK” is common in clinical microbiology, although its pronunciation may be somewhat controversial (hay-sek or hah-sek?). ![]()
